A 1936 Black Grade Wound Badge Authorization Document Auction Archive (Had spent 4-5 days inA certificate for being eligible to wear the Wound Badge in Black. It measures 209x148mm, very fine condition with folding creases, some age spots, and two punched holes. The certificate is called a Berechtigungsausweis, which translates to permit ID.
